Ryde Therapy Manager
Full time

A fantastic opportunity exists to join Cerebral Palsy Alliance team as the Therapy Manager of our Ryde site.

The Ryde therapy team in 2024 will consist of 11 therapists. Whilst the overall caseload is mixed ages, the majority of our clients are peadiatric and infants. We host a weekly clinic for early intervention focussed on working with children as young as 2 weeks old who are at risk of having Cerebral Palsy.

In this role you will be supported not only by the Regional Manager (to whom the position reports) but by a network of therapy managers across CPA, and in particular the Allambie managers and team leaders. You will also have access to various modes of leadership training including online courses and face to face sessions facilitated by Regional Managers, internal business partners and external subject matter experts.

The position is site-based, but there may be some flexibility to work from home one day per week once settled in the role for a candidate with the right experience. There will also be days spent at head office in Allambie (Sydney) as required.

Clinical background is essential.
